Winter Midweek Climbing We will be meeting indoors at one of the local climbing walls from 18:00 onwards on every Tuesday night until 6 April 2010. This winter we will be visiting four different walls. First Tuesday of each month will be in Shrewsbury, Second and Fourth Tuesdays in Wolverhampton, Third Tuesdays at Newport and any Fifth Tuesdays in Birmingham. This is the outline calendar and you can expect to find other club members present on these nights. Keen members of the club will be out climbing more than one night a week and some members will always tend to use their local wall even when the ‘official' meet is elsewhere. Use the bulletin board to keep in touch and to arrange lift sharing.

No rock boots available to hire There is one easy bouldering wall and a harder bouldering wall as well as 12 vertical to overhanging roped panels with three routes per panel that can be top roped or led. Typical grades run from English 4a to 6c. You have to prove you can put on a harness, tie in and belay to climb here, otherwise you can just boulder. If another club member is present they can ‘look after' you so you can climb. You need to phone to check if someone is available to test you if you have not climbed here before. There is a wide range of bouldering and over 40 panels of top rope or leading routes. Typical grades run from French 3 to 7+. You have to prove you can put on a harness, tie in and belay to climb here, otherwise you can just boulder. This wall has extensive bouldering circuits with over 100 problems from V0 to V6+. There are also ten roped panels with two routes per panel. You have to prove you can put on a harness, tie in and belay to climb here, otherwise you can boulder.
